Institutional ownership is the percentage of shares that are owned by institutions out of the total shares outstanding. As of today, Rocket Lab's institutional ownership is 37.95%.

Insider Ownership is the percentage of shares that are owned by company insiders relative to the total shares outstanding. As of today, Rocket Lab's Insider Ownership is 0.00%.

Float Percentage Of Total Shares Outstanding is the percentage of float shares relative to the total shares outstanding. As of today, Rocket Lab's Float Percentage Of Total Shares Outstanding is 92.06%.

Rocket Lab Business Description

Other Exchanges RKLB:USA6RJ0:Germany
Address 3881 McGowen Street, Long Beach, CA, USA, 90808
Rocket Lab Corp is engaged in space, building rockets, and spacecraft. It provides end-to-end mission services that provide frequent and reliable access to space for civil, defense, and commercial markets. It designs and manufactures the Electron and Neutron launch vehicles and Photon satellite platform. Rocket Lab's Electron launch vehicle has delivered multiple satellites to orbit for private and public sector organizations, enabling operations in national security, scientific research, space debris mitigation, Earth observation, climate monitoring, and communications. The business operates in two segments Launch Services and Space Systems. Geographically it serves Japan, and rest of the world and earns key revenue from the United States.
